Luciano Pavarotti
1935–2007
Über Luciano Pavarotti
The most famous tenor of the modern era, Luciano Pavarotti brought opera to a mass audience without ever cheapening it. His ringing high notes and warm Modena charm made him a global star, and his 1990 performance of Nessun Dorma at the World Cup became one of the defining musical moments of the century. As one of the Three Tenors he filled stadiums, and his Pavarotti and Friends concerts paired him with rock and pop stars while raising money for humanitarian causes.
